Michael D. Eisner Michael D. Eisner

is the founder of The Tornante Company, a media and entertainment investment company, and a trustee of The Aspen Institute. In 1984, Eisner became chairman and CEO of The Walt Disney Company and, over 21 years, transformed it from a film and theme park company with $3 billion in enterprise value to a global media empire valued at $60 billion. Eisner began his career at ABC, where he helped take the network from No. 3 to No. 1 in primetime, daytime, and children’s television with landmark shows like “Happy Days” and “Barney Miller,” as well as the acclaimed miniseries Roots. In 1977, he became president of Paramount Pictures, leading the studio to No. 1 in box office and profitability in both theatrical movies and network TV production.
